Boc-L-prolinal (CAS 69610-41-9), with the molecular formula C10H17NO3 and a molecular weight of 199.25 g/mol, is a crucial chiral building block. This protected amino aldehyde derivative is frequently employed in complex organic synthesis. Its primary utility lies in its role as a key intermediate for the construction of various biologically relevant molecules, including alkaloids and other complex natural products. 01 /Applications

Synthesis of Norsecurinine-Type Alkaloids

Boc-L-prolinal serves as a vital precursor in the total synthesis of norsecurinine-type alkaloids. Its specific stereochemistry and functional groups enable the efficient construction of the complex polycyclic framework characteristic of these natural products.

Construction of Isaindigotidione Carboskeleton

This compound is utilized as a key building block for assembling the isaindigotidione carboskeleton. Its application facilitates the stereoselective formation of critical carbon-carbon bonds required for creating this intricate molecular architecture.

Peptide Chemistry and Modifications

As a protected amino aldehyde derived from L-proline, Boc-L-prolinal is valuable in peptide chemistry. It can be incorporated into peptide chains or used for modifying peptides, introducing specific structural features or functionalities.

Chiral Synthesis and Organic Building Blocks

Boc-L-prolinal is a versatile chiral synthon used in various asymmetric synthesis pathways. Its aldehyde functionality allows for diverse chemical transformations, making it a useful building block for creating complex organic molecules.

02 /Properties
Molecular weight199.25
Empirical formulaC10H17NO3
Assay97%
Boiling point211 °C(lit.)
Density1.063 g/mL at 25 °C(lit.)
Refractive indexn20/D 1.462(lit.)
Optical activity[α]20/D −101°, c = 0.66 in chloroform
Storage temperature−20°C

How should Boc-L-prolinal be handled safely?

+

Boc-L-prolinal is a flammable liquid and vapour (H226) and can cause skin irritation (H315), serious eye irritation (H319), and respiratory irritation (H335). Handle with appropriate personal protective equipment, including eyeshields and gloves, in a well-ventilated area. Store away from heat and ignition sources.
